  1. 1 Whether the Defendant breached the mutual termination and release agreement by failing to cancel and transfer the Claimants’ visas
  2. 2 Whether the Defendant’s alleged financial losses justify non-performance

Ratio Decidendi

Defendant failed to perform its contractual obligation to cancel and transfer Claimants’ visas as agreed, violating Articles 59(1) and 77 of DIFC Contract Law.

Court Disposition

claim allowed

Orders

  • Defendant shall cancel both Claimants’ visas
  • Each party shall bear their own costs
